Job Description:

An offer entitled “DevOPS Engineer – Cyber-Training Platform (m/f)” has just opened within Airbus CyberSecurity. You will join the Engineering department whose mission is to ensure the security “by Design” of information systems, to integrate security software and equipment, to deploy them and to train users. This department has created a cyber-training platform allowing the carrying out of operational exercises (ethical hacking, cyber crisis management, etc.), cybersecurity challenges (CTF, Red Team vs Blue Team, etc) as well as product testing. The platform is equipped with an innovative tool allowing the deployment of virtual network infrastructures on demand to carry out cyber-attacks.

Job Responsibility:

  • Create innovative architectures to demonstrate recent vulnerabilities, demonstrate system or network concepts, design CTF challenges, design training labs
  • Research and develop new computer attacks that can be integrated into this tool as well as associated countermeasures
  • Software integration into Linux and Windows operating systems
  • Participate in the creation of tests as part of future cybersecurity challenges or as part of training
  • Lead training sessions and challenges

Requirements:

  • Master of Science diploma in a course providing a solid foundation in programming and networks
  • Good general knowledge of Linux and Windows systems as well as IT security
  • Good command of the following programming languages is required: JavaScript, Python
  • Good knowledge of REST architectures as well as the VMware and Docker ecosystems
  • Intermediate level written and spoken English is required
  • A spirit of synthesis and excellent writing skills are expected
  • Dynamic, with excellent interpersonal skills, passionate about your job and with a taste for service
  • This position requires security clearance or requires being eligible for clearance by recognized authorities

Nice to have:

You are aware of good coding practices, which is a plus
